#ba6198 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ba6198 is composed of 72.9% red, 38%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 47.8% magenta, 18.3%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 322.9 degrees, a saturation of 39.2% and a lightness of 55.5%. #ba6198 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c2ff with #750031.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

#ba6198 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ba6198 has RGB values of R:186, G:97,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.48, Y:0.18,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12214680.

Shades and Tints of #ba6198
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060305 is the darkest color, while #fcf7f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#ba6198
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e8d8e is the less saturated color, while #f724a6 is the most saturated one.
